semi-fun fact

I wrote to the Brothers Chaps asking about a possible Emberley influence, and got a reply on on January 13, 2003:

"we learned to draw from the big green drawing book and ed emberley's make a
world. great stuff.
-mike"

Not interesting enough for the main page, perhaps, but it was nice of them to reply. S Gleason 02:49, 23 Jun 2005 (UTC)
